There'* more to driving then smashing your foot to the floor and holding it there. I spent a lot of time learning my car. I found if I smashed my foot I did 0-60 in 5.4 seconds, sometimes a bit more. But if I worked the gas, listened to the tires and watched the RPMs I could hit 0-60 in 5 seconds flat. Same car, different driving. You can take a nice car with a great driver, and he will blow away a great car with a OK driver every time.
